### Seafood Restaurants in Eight Mile Plains: A Local Review
Eight Mile Plains, a suburb of Brisbane, boasts a growing array of seafood dining options that cater to both locals and tourists alike. With its proximity to the coast, this area offers some delightful venues where fresh seafood takes center stage.
**Recommended Seafood Restaurants**
One of the standout seafood restaurants in Eight Mile Plains is **The Fish Market**, known for its vibrant atmosphere and an extensive menu featuring everything from crispy fish and chips to gourmet seafood platters. Locals rave about their signature grilled barramundi and fresh oysters, often recommending it as a go-to spot for casual dining. Prices here are reasonable, with most main dishes ranging from AUD 20 to AUD 40.
Another popular choice is **Café Fish**, praised for its cozy ambiance and friendly service. This family-run establishment is particularly loved for its daily specials and fresh catch of the day. Visitors often highlight their prawn linguine and clam chowder as must-tries, with average prices hovering around AUD 15 to AUD 30.
For those seeking an upscale experience, **Ocean’s Table** presents an elegant dining environment with a focus on sustainable seafood. The reviews frequently mention their contemporary dishes, such as seared scallops and lobster risotto. Expect to pay a bit more here, with prices typically between AUD 30 and AUD 60 per dish.
